Hikvision Erhält Branchenweit Erste EUCC-Zertifizierung Für Netzwerkkameras

TL;DR

Hikvision has become the first company in the security industry to receive the EUCC certification for its network cameras. This certification confirms compliance with European Union cybersecurity standards, potentially setting a new industry benchmark.

Hikvision has achieved the first industry-wide EUCC certification for its network cameras, a move that underscores its commitment to European cybersecurity standards. The certification, announced by Hikvision on March 2024, is a significant milestone that could influence industry practices and regulatory compliance across Europe.

The European Union Cybersecurity Certification (EUCC) is a new regulatory framework aimed at ensuring the security and resilience of networked devices within the EU. Hikvision, a leading provider of security cameras, announced that its network cameras have received this certification, marking the first time a company has achieved such recognition in the industry.

According to Hikvision, the EUCC certification verifies that its network cameras meet strict cybersecurity requirements set by European regulators. The certification process involved comprehensive testing and assessments of the devices’ security features, including data protection, threat mitigation, and firmware integrity.

This certification is expected to facilitate Hikvision’s continued market access within the European Union, where regulatory compliance is increasingly a prerequisite for product sales and installation. Hikvision’s spokesperson emphasized that the certification demonstrates their commitment to security and regulatory adherence, aligning with European standards.

Background on EU Cybersecurity Certification Frameworks

The EU has been advancing its cybersecurity regulatory framework through initiatives like the EU Cybersecurity Act, which established the EUCC as a certification scheme for ICT products. The EUCC aims to ensure that devices sold within the EU meet uniform security standards, reducing vulnerabilities and enhancing trust.

Prior to this certification, most network cameras and IoT devices lacked standardized cybersecurity certification, often relying on self-assessment or compliance with national standards. Hikvision’s achievement marks a departure from this norm, showcasing a proactive approach to European cybersecurity expectations.

Hikvision, a major global provider, has faced scrutiny over security concerns in the past, making this certification a noteworthy development in its European strategy. The company states that it is committed to aligning its products with European regulatory standards to maintain market access and trust.

Key Questions

What is the EUCC certification?

The EU Cybersecurity Certification (EUCC) is a regulatory scheme established by the European Union to ensure connected devices meet stringent cybersecurity standards, enhancing security and trust within the EU market.

What does Hikvision’s certification mean for European customers?

The certification indicates that Hikvision’s network cameras comply with European cybersecurity standards, potentially increasing trust and enabling broader market access within the EU.

Will this certification be mandatory for all network cameras sold in Europe?

It is not yet clear if the EU will make such certifications mandatory for all products. However, regulatory developments suggest a trend toward stricter cybersecurity requirements for connected devices.

How might this affect Hikvision’s reputation?

Receiving the EUCC certification could improve Hikvision’s credibility in Europe, especially given past security concerns, and may help it expand its market share.

Are other manufacturers pursuing similar certifications?

It remains to be seen whether other companies will seek EUCC certification, but industry observers expect increased interest as standards evolve and enforcement begins.
